So, Chanson from '77 is a bit of a mystery, honestly. The atmosphere is thick, almost dreamlike, with a pacing that feels both languid and intentional. It weaves themes of longing and existential reflection, often leaving you with more questions than answers. The performances, while not widely recognized, carry a weight that sticks with you. What makes this one stand out? It’s got this raw, unfiltered vibe that’s hard to pin down. Practical effects? Not much, but the way they use sound and silence creates a haunting effect that lingers. It’s a unique piece that doesn’t quite fit in any box, which is part of its charm.
Chanson is somewhat elusive in the collector’s market, often appearing only sporadically. Finding a decent copy can be a challenge, as it hasn’t been widely circulated on modern formats. Interest among collectors is growing, especially for those who appreciate unique narratives and experimental cinema. It's definitely worth keeping an eye out for any releases, especially if you’re into films that defy easy categorization.
